Ontario_Association_of_Former_Parliamentarians
The Ontario Association of Former Parliamentarians (OAFP) is a non-profit volunteer organization created to serve former Members of the Ontario Legislative Assembly.

Established by an act of the legislature in 2000,[1] the objectives of the association are:
- to put the knowledge and experience of its members at the service of parliamentary democracy in Ontario and elsewhere
- to serve the public interest by providing non-partisan support for the parliamentary system of government in Ontario
- to foster a spirit of community among former parliamentarians
- to foster good relations between members of the Legislative Assembly of the Province of Ontario and former parliamentarians
- to protect and promote the interests of former parliamentarians
The association is strictly non-partisan[1] and has former members from all three political parties serving on its board of directors.
